History of the Stenhousemuir v Stirling Albion fixture

Stenhousemuir play host to Stirling Albion at Ochilview Park on Saturday afternoon, needing to improve on a poor record between the sides. The visitors have won 15 of the 43 previous games, with the Warriors winning just 14.

The last time the two teams met at Stenhousemuir was back in January 2001, over five years ago, where the two sides shared the spoils courtesy of a 1-1 final scoreline in a Scottish Division Two match.

Recent respective form guides

Stenhousemuir have only performed averagely at home, winning 3 and losing 2 of their last six. The Warriors's have scored 7 goals in these games, but conceded an alarming 8.

The Binos have had a decent run of form away from home recently, tasting just one defeat in their last six, and picking up four good wins. The games have constituted a decent return of 10 goals for the Binos, and 6 goals against.

Stenhousemuir see themselves just below half way in the Irn Bru Scottish Division Two, showing a record of 10 points from their 9 games played so far, Stirling Alb. are leading the way in the Irn Bru Scottish Division Two, with their 9 games giving them a return of 20 points.
